Category : | Sub Category : IoT-Enhanced Home Energy Management Posted on 2023-10-30 21:24:53
Introduction In today's fast-paced digital world, the Internet of Things (IoT) has become an integral part of our lives. From smart homes to industrial automation, IoT systems are transforming the way we interact with the world around us. However, with this massive influx of data comes the need for advanced computing infrastructure. Enter edge computing, a technology that promises to revolutionize the way we process and analyze data from IoT devices. In this blog post, we will explore the concept of edge computing for IoT systems and its potential to drive innovation. Understanding Edge Computing Edge computing refers to the practice of processing and analyzing data at or near the source of its generation, rather than sending it to a centralized cloud server for processing. By doing so, edge computing eliminates the need for data to traverse long distances to reach a central server, reducing latency, bandwidth usage, and improving real-time analysis capabilities. This is particularly crucial for IoT systems, where low-latency and real-time decision-making are essential. Challenges Faced by IoT Systems While IoT systems offer numerous benefits, they also present unique challenges. One of the major challenges is the sheer volume of data generated by IoT devices. Sending all this data to a centralized cloud server for processing can result in significant network congestion and increased latency. Moreover, in scenarios where the devices are deployed in remote or mobile environments, reliance on cloud servers becomes impractical due to limited connectivity and high communication costs. Edge Computing as a Solution Edge computing addresses these challenges by bringing computation closer to the data source. By deploying edge computing devices, known as edge nodes, directly within IoT systems, data processing can be done at the edge of the network. This not only reduces data transfer time and network congestion but also enables real-time decision-making. The edge nodes act as gateways between the IoT devices and the centralized cloud infrastructure, enabling seamless integration of the two. Benefits of Edge Computing for IoT Systems 1. Reduced Latency: By processing data at the edge, latency is significantly reduced, resulting in faster response times and improved user experiences. 2. Bandwidth Optimization: Edge computing helps optimize bandwidth consumption by minimizing unnecessary data transfer to the cloud. Only relevant and actionable data is transmitted, leading to reduced communication costs. 3. Enhanced Reliability: Edge computing eliminates single points of failure by distributing computation across multiple nodes. This improves the reliability and resilience of IoT systems, especially in mission-critical applications. 4. Privacy and Security: Data processed at the edge is not transmitted to the cloud, addressing concerns related to data privacy and security. This is particularly important in highly regulated industries, such as healthcare and finance. 5. Scalability: Edge computing provides scalable infrastructure that can handle the growing demands of IoT systems. Additional edge nodes can be easily deployed to accommodate increased data processing requirements. Conclusion Edge computing holds immense potential for IoT systems, paving the way for a more intelligent, responsive, and efficient future. By processing data at the source, edge computing enables real-time decision-making, reduces latency, enhances security, and optimizes bandwidth usage. As the adoption of IoT systems continues to soar, organizations must embrace the power of edge computing to unlock the full potential of their IoT deployments. The orphans of IoT - devices that are disconnected or remote - can now break free from their dependence on centralized cloud servers and stand at the edge of innovation. To get all the details, go through http://www.aitam.org